> I am attempting to edit two dhcpService attributes (dhcpPrimaryDN and dhcpSecondaryDN).  I've done this edit countless times before.  But I seem to be unable to edit these fields in either a copy of a pre-existing one or a new entry cloned from another.  On the system console (via Console.app), Eclipse is continually throwing a stack trace (see below). Apologies if this is a dupe.  I was unable to locate a similar JIRA, but then again my JIRA-fu is weak.
> !ENTRY org.eclipse.ui 4 0 2008-03-16 08:58:08.332
> !MESSAGE Unhandled event loop exception
> !STACK 0
> java.lang.NoSuchMethodError: org.apache.directory.studio.ldapbrowser.common.widgets.search.EntryWidget.<init>(Lorg/apache/directory/studio/ldapbrowser/core/model/IBrowserConnection;Lorg/apache/directory/studio/ldapbrowser/core/model/DN;)V
